Abstract

A planar connector holder for optical fibers with a storage facility for coiled fiber, a mounting region at the front end region of the holder for connectors with an end of each connector facing forwardly. The holder has a connector guard to shield the forward facing ends of the connectors. The shield is located in front of the mounting region to define a space for other optical fibers to be connected to the forward facing ends of the connectors. Provision is made for limiting the minimum bend radius of fibers as they enter into this space and then laterally of the holder through an inlet to the space.
